Trillium Health Resources manages specialty behavioral health care for North Carolinians across 46 counties. We help those with mental health conditions, intellectual and developmental disabilities, traumatic brain injury, and substance use disorders (Medicaid members and state-funded recipients) get the services they need to improve well-being and live fulfilling lives.
